Offensichtlich hast du eine Einstellung gewählt, die so nicht von deiner Hardware oder von X unterstützt wird. Versuche mal folgendes. Lösche die Datei xf86config im Verzeichnis /etc/X11.
Dann starte erneut die Konfigurationen, wie du es auch immer bevorzugst. Ich persönlich finde xf86cfg -textmode am angenehmsten.

Dort nimmst du dann mal wieder alle notwendigen Einstellungen vor, allerdings schön konservativ, z. B. 640x480x8.
